The Myth of the Small Goldfish BowlBefore diving into the mathematics, it is important to expose the most damaging myth in the fish-keeping hobby: the "bowl."
Goldfish do not stop growing due to the fact that their tank is small. Instead, a limited environment triggers a cruel physiological reaction called stunting. While the Fish Stock Calculator's external development may appear to slow down, its internal organs continue to grow at a typical rate. This leads to severe deformities, tremendous suffering, organ failure, and a significantly reduced life-span.
Correctly looked after, a goldfish can live for 10 to 15 years-- and sometimes even longer-- maturing to a foot long depending upon the range.
Why Goldfish Need So Much WaterGoldfish require large volumes of water for three primary reasons:
- Waste Production: Unlike many exotic Fish Tank Stocking Calculator, goldfish lack a stomach. Food travels through their digestion systems rapidly, suggesting they produce a huge quantity of strong waste. In addition, they excrete a high volume of ammonia straight through their gills.
- Oxygen Demand: Goldfish thrive in cool, well-oxygenated water. Bigger bodies of water hold liquified oxygen more stably than small volumes.
- Swimming Space: Goldfish are active swimmers and foragers. They need physical space to stretch their fins and browse their environment without stress.

1. Single-Tail Goldfish (Common, Comet, Shubunkin)Single-tail goldfish are structured, quick swimmers that can reach lengths of 10 to 14 inches. Due to the fact that of their size and activity level, they are essentially unsuited for basic indoor aquariums and are typically best kept in large ponds.
- Minimum Tank Size for One: 75 gallons
- Add per additional Fish Tank Size Calculator: 50 gallons
Fancy goldfish have egg-shaped bodies, double tails, and often cranial growths (wen) or delicate eyes. While they are slower swimmers and do not reach the massive lengths of single-tails, they are still heavy waste producers.
- Minimum Tank Size for One: 20 to 30 gallons
- Add per extra fish: 10 to 20 gallons

Tank measurements are similarly crucial.
- Area: Goldfish need a high surface-to-volume ratio to help with gas exchange (oxygen getting in the water, carbon dioxide leaving). Long, rectangular tanks are far superior to tall, narrow, or round tanks.
- Footprint: Because goldfish invest the majority of their time foraging at the bottom of the tank, a wide and long floor plan supplies more functional home than vertical height.
A big Tank Stocking Calculator is only reliable when coupled with proper life-support systems. Because goldfish produce such a heavy biological load, aquarists should buy robust equipment:
- Filtration: The general rule for goldfish filtering is to acquire a filter ranked for two times the size of the real tank. If handling a 40-gallon elegant goldfish tank, utilize a filter rated for a minimum of 80 gallons. Cylinder filters and large internal sponge filters are leading choices.
- Water Agitation: Water pumps, air stones, and powerheads assist keep high oxygen saturation levels, which goldfish desperately need.
- Water Testing Kits: Because goldfish produce ammonia and nitrite rapidly, a liquid-based master test set is obligatory to keep an eye on water criteria.
- Trusted Substrate or Bare Bottom: Many goldfish keepers prefer a "bare bottom" tank to make vacuuming up waste much easier, though fine sand is safe if owners want a more natural look (avoid gravel, which goldfish can accidentally swallow and choke on).
Even with a mathematically perfect tank size, goldfish require regular upkeep to thrive. Water volume waters down waste, however it does not remove it totally.
- Weekly Water Changes: Plan to alter 30% to 50% of the Aquarium Calculator water each and every single week.
- Waste Removal: Use a gravel vacuum or siphon to clean the substrate of remaining food and feces throughout every water modification.
- Filter Maintenance: Rinse filter media in old tank water (never ever faucet water, which eliminates useful germs) as soon as a month to make sure ideal water circulation.
